fortran95 相关问题

Fortran 95是一个小修订版,主要用于解决Fortran 90标准中的一些突出问题。它的继任者是Fortran 2003,它在现代编译器中得到广泛应用。使用此标记的问题应该特定于定义为Fortran 95的语言,而不是更一般的Fortran问题。这些问题也应该有Fortran标签。

在 Fortran 中是否应该避免使用名单?如果是的话,推荐的替代方案是什么?

我经常使用 namelist 功能来灵活地将参数列表输入到 FORTRAN 程序中,但是有一天,当我搜索以提醒自己它们的用途时,我遇到了这样的说法: 它(名字...

回答 2 投票 0

这些条件与.and有什么区别。和.或.?

A) if (ask /= "y" .and.ask /= "Y") then 出口 万一 二) if (ask /= "y" .or.ask /= "Y") then 出口 万一 我还是 Fortran 的初学者,所以 p...

回答 1 投票 0

我需要知道这两个fortran代码之间的区别,请有人解释一下吗?

A) if (ask /= "y" .and.ask /= "Y") then 出口 万一 B) if (ask /= "y" .or.ask /= "Y") then 出口 万一 我还是 Fortran 初学者,所以请解释一下...

回答 1 投票 0

与Fortran程序相关,

我想我在txt文件中有一个数据集(数字)。它有 10 个列和 80 个原始数据。 我打开、读取这些数据并将其存储在 Fortran 程序的数组中。 然后我再次将数组中的数据写入另一个......

回答 0 投票 0

运行这段代码时出现编译错误:

我正在编译 Fortran 代码但出现错误。错误,例如当我编写任何一行代码时它都已成功编译 例如:write(,) 'Line 813',sigav 但是当同一行被评论时 ...

回答 0 投票 0

Fortran 运行时错误:浮点读取期间的错误值 (ES14.6E2)

我正在尝试执行 Fortran 代码,但出现以下错误: 在文件 src/annGeneralization.f90 的第 79 行(单位 = 12,文件 = './output/ann1_1.out') Fortran 运行时错误:

回答 1 投票 0

"总线错误 "和 "munmap_chunk(): Fortran 95中的 "无效指针

我正在做一个python项目,为了提高效率,通过f2py调用一个fortran子程序。当我执行这段代码时,它在看似随机(非一致)的点上失败,并出现Segmentation Fault ...

回答 1 投票 0

是否有相当于在Python中解压缩参数列表的Fortran?

我也在写我的第一个数值优化程序(牛顿方法)和我的第一个Fortran程序。我开始使用Python来了解第一个问题,现在我要移植到Fortran上以进行工作...

回答 1 投票 0

子程序分段错误

程序olaf隐式无整数:: i,j,nc,nd,ok,iter REAL :: alph,bet,chi,ninf1,C1,ninf2,C2 REAL,DIMENSION(:),...

回答 1 投票 0

fortran整数的位大小

我有以下程序给出一个最小的例子,我对通用或Fortran中的位表示都不了解。如果我使用gfortran 7.5或ifort 18.0进行编译,它将通过所有...

回答 1 投票 0


将矩阵插入fortran

如何将矩阵插入fortran程序?我有一个脚本:程序矩阵隐式无整数,参数:: size = 20实数,Dimensions(1:size,1:size):: M1,M2,M整数:: a,b,c,i,j print。 ..

回答 1 投票 0

并排显示两列数组

我是Fortran的新手,我想并排显示2列数组,因此我可以创建它们的显示表。到目前为止,我只能一次又一次地显示它们,但至少要在一列中显示它们。 ...

回答 1 投票 0

在Fortran中列出目录的内容

如何在Fortran 95中获得目录的内容?

回答 5 投票 1

Fortran函数返回意外的类型和值

我正在一个需要在Fortran中实现少量数值方法的项目中。为此,我需要编写一些递归函数。这是我的代码。 ! !文件:main.F95!递归功能...

回答 3 投票 6

Fortran代码在尝试打开文本文件时产生运行时错误'不支持操作'

我正在尝试运行一段用f95编写的fortran代码。我已经在Ubuntu中使用gfortran对其进行了编译。在代码中,有一个命令可以读取文本文件。当我运行它时,它为我提供了以下...

回答 1 投票 0

如何摆脱特定的gfortran警告?

我有一条警告消息,它经常在我的构建日志中出现。它是由某些我无法修改的外部来源引起的。该警告消息是:名为COMMON块' ] >>

回答 1 投票 0

乘两个矩阵的行,以获得一个标量按照Fortran [重复]

几年后,不使用Fortran语言的我有一些麻烦与MATMUL。假设我有两个矩阵:A_ {N,K}和{B_ J,K}。我想创建一个子程序,它采取的行和B的一行,...

回答 1 投票 1

将3列的2行矩阵数组写入Fortran 95中的输出文本文件

我正在学习如何编写矩阵阵列来输出Fortran 95中的文本文件。我面临的问题是,我正在研究的2行3列矩阵阵列,不是格式化为什么...

回答 2 投票 0

在Fortran中编写多个输出文件

亲爱的所有人,我正在编写一个代码,将输出写入名为1.dat,2.dat,.....的多个文件中。这是我的代码,但它提供了一些不寻常的输出。你可以告诉我我的代码有什么问题吗? ...

回答 2 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.